117.info
人生若只如初见

Spring Boot中的Endpoints是什么

在Spring Boot中,endpoints(端点)是应用程序提供的一种功能或服务,可以通过网络访问。这些端点通常用于执行特定任务、获取信息或与应用程序进行交互。端点可以是RESTful API、WebSocket连接或其他类型的网络接口。

Spring Boot提供了许多内置的端点,这些端点可以帮助开发人员监控和管理应用程序。这些内置端点包括:

  1. /health:提供应用程序的健康状况信息。
  2. /info:提供应用程序的基本信息,如版本号、构建时间等。
  3. /metrics:提供应用程序的性能指标,如CPU使用率、内存使用情况等。
  4. /env:提供应用程序的环境变量信息。
  5. /configprops:提供应用程序的配置属性信息。
  6. /mappings:提供应用程序中的所有URL映射信息。
  7. /beans:提供应用程序中的所有Spring Bean信息。

这些内置端点可以通过配置文件进行自定义和扩展,以满足不同的需求。此外,开发人员还可以创建自定义端点,以提供更多的功能和服务。

总之,在Spring Boot中,endpoints是应用程序提供的一种功能或服务,可以通过网络访问。这些端点可以帮助开发人员监控和管理应用程序,并提供更多的功能和服务。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e6bfAzsPBwNeBg.html

推荐文章

  • 如何在Spring Boot中测试Endpoints

    在Spring Boot中测试endpoints,通常使用Spring Boot Test模块和相关的测试工具 添加依赖项 确保你的项目中包含了以下依赖: org.springframework.boot spring-b...

  • Spring Boot Endpoints的错误处理机制

    Spring Boot 提供了一个灵活的错误处理机制,可以帮助我们在 Web 应用程序中更好地处理错误和异常。以下是 Spring Boot 中处理错误的一些建议和最佳实践: 使用 ...

  • 如何优化Spring Boot Endpoints的性能

    要优化Spring Boot Endpoints的性能,可以采取以下措施: 使用缓存:为了提高性能,可以使用缓存来存储经常访问的数据。Spring Boot支持多种缓存技术,如EhCache...

  • Spring Boot Endpoints的版本控制策略

    在Spring Boot中,对Endpoints进行版本控制是一个重要的实践,它有助于确保系统的稳定性和可维护性。以下是关于Spring Boot Endpoints版本控制的相关信息:

  • C++中布尔类型与其他数据类型的交互

    在C++中,布尔类型(bool)用于表示真或假 布尔类型与整数类型的交互:
    当布尔类型与整数类型进行运算时,布尔值true会被转换为1,而false会被转换为0。例如...

  • 布尔类型在C++中的最佳实践

    在 C++ 中,布尔类型(bool)用于表示真或假 使用关键字 true 和 false:在 C++ 中,布尔值可以用关键字 true 和 false 表示。这比使用整数值 1 和 0 更具可读性...

  • C++ less操作符与什么区别

    在 C++ 中,less 是一个函数对象(也称为比较器或仿函数),用于执行“小于”操作。它通常用于排序和查找算法,如 std::sort 和 std::find。less 函数对象在` 头...

  • 如何在C++中使用less进行排序

    在C++中,std::sort()函数可以用于对容器(如vector、array等)进行排序
    #include
    #include
    #include // 包含 std::sort() 和 std::less int mai...